Yi Lin is an of counsel at Global Law Office based in Chengdu, primarily focusing on corporate risk control and compliance, information security, and personal information protection.
Having served as a global program manager and senior consultant at renowned multinational corporation and certification body, He has over 20 years of domain experience and has successfully delivered over 50 project implementations in 14 countries.
Yi Lin excels at prioritizing compliance tasks based on regulatory requirements and industry oversight trends, then defining risk management objectives based on an organization's developmental stage and governance goals. He assists clients in achieving their management objectives, including obtaining system certifications, by implementing comprehensive service solutions that integrate law and management, and based on international standards & best practices.
Employers and clients he has served include several Fortune 500 groups, spanning sectors such as end-to-end semiconductors, ICT and smart terminals, smart devices and consumer electronics, home appliance manufacturing, steel production, and mining & commodity trading. He has also advised a globally renowned luxury group, an IT services and solutions provider, a well-known online design platform, a leading global bicycle component manufacturer, and leading medical groups and data center operators in the Asia-Pacific region.
Yi Lin holds CIPP/E, CIPM, CIPT, and CIPP/CN certifications from the International Association of Privacy Professionals (IAPP). As one of the first certified individuals in China, he participated in the subsequent body of knowledge planning and the development of bilingual exam questions for two of these certifications. He also holds PMP and CSM certifications in project management.
